White marker
Use this option to change a specific color on the image to white. This effectively highlights
(or hides) the selected color.
Temperature graph
The temperature graph is used to illustrate changes in water temperature.
When toggled on, a colored line and temperature digits are shown on the Echosounder
image.
Bottom line
A bottom line can be added to the bottom surface to make it easier to distinguish the
bottom from fish and structures.
Toggle enable/disable the Bottom line from the bottom line sub-menu. Turning the rotary
knob or pressing the up/down arrow keys moves the slide bar up/down and specifies the
thickness of the bottom line.
A-Scope
The A-scope is a display of real-time echoes as they appear on the panel. The strength of the
actual echo is indicated by both width and color intensity.
Zoom bars
The zoom bars are displayed when you activate a split zoom image and activate the zoom
bar on the View menu. Refer to "Zoom" on page 17.
The range zoom bars on the right side of the display shows the range that is magnified and
displayed on the left side. If you increase the zooming factor, the range is reduced. You see
this as reduced distance between the zoom bars.
You can move the zoom bars on the right side up or down to cause the left side image to
show different depths of the water column.
You activate the cursor and display the cursor icon by pressing the left or right arrow keys
You deactivate the cursor and remove the cursor icon from the image by pressing the
Clear cursor softbar key or the Exit key
You move the cursor within the image by pressing the arrow keys. Move the cursor left/
right to pan history. Move the cursor up/down to view different depths of the water
column in the zoom panel.
